WHAT THE CONSTITUTION MEANS TO ME

Written by Heidi Schreck
Directed by Peggy Metzger

September 5 - 28

Redwood Curtain Theatre

Fifteen year old Heidi earned her college tuition by winning Constitutional debate competitions across the country. In this Tony and Pulitzer-nominated, hilarious, hopeful and achingly human new play, adult Heidi resurrects her teenage self in order to trace the profound relationship between four generations of women and the founding document that shaped their lives.

Other information you might want to know:

This show runs about two hours including one intermission. It's funny, it's serious, it's a ray of hope and a call to action. Although not adult oriented, there are some serious themes (abortion, violence against women) but nothing a middle schooler has never heard about.
